Irony-Laden Quote of the Moment…

Share article:

Said Norm Coleman, as he announced his election contest:

Democracy is not a machine. Sometimes it’s messy and inconvenient, and reaching the best conclusion is never quick because speed is not the first objective, fairness is.”

He also added, as if he was serious, “We are filing this contest to make absolutely sure every valid vote was counted.”

The sore-loser Coleman, who refuses to move on, was explaining his tin-foil hat conspiracy theories of a stolen election to reporters and cry-baby supporters, as he made the sour-grapes comments which threaten democracy, as quoted above.
